Top attractions around Rose House Museum

When visiting the Rose House Museum in Prince Edward, Ontario, immerse yourself in the local culture by exploring the museum and taking a guided tour. Nearby, you can enjoy the natural beauty of urban parks and reserves, or visit historical churches. These attractions provide a perfect blend of family-friendly activities and outdoor experiences, making your stay both enriching and enjoyable.

  1. Lake on the Mountain Provincial Park: A serene natural reserve featuring breathtaking views of the lake. Ideal for relaxation and enjoying the tranquil environment, it offers scenic walking trails and picnic spots.
  2. Old Hay Bay Church National Historic Site: A historic church showcasing rich cultural significance, this site reflects the area's heritage. Visitors can explore the architecture and learn about its role in local history.
  3. County Youth Park: A vibrant urban park perfect for families, featuring playgrounds, sports facilities, and open green spaces for outdoor activities and community events.

Things to do recommended for couples

For a romantic getaway near Rose House Museum, indulge in wine tasting at Waupoos Winery, just 3.2km away, or explore the charming 33 Vines Winery, 20.9km away. Don’t miss Huff Estates Winery, 27.4km down the road, for enchanting views and delightful sips together.

Things to do recommended for families

Families can explore the United Empire Loyalist Heritage Centre, located 6.4km from Rose House Museum, where they can enjoy recreational activities in a serene environment perfect for relaxation and wellness.

Things to do recommended for groups

During your visit to the Rose House Museum, enjoy a tasting at the County Cider Company, just 1.6km away, for a romantic vibe. Play a round of golf at Picton Golf and Country Club, or catch a show at the Regent Theatre, both within 16.1km.

Best time to go to Rose House Museum

If you're planning a trip to Rose House Museum,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is July. Peak season runs from July to September, while off-peak times, like January to March tend to have fewer bookings and better deals.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January21.2°F (-6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
February22.5°F (-5.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
March31.5°F (-0.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
April42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July70.5°F (21.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
August69.4°F (20.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
September62.8°F (17.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
October51.1°F (10.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November39.0°F (3.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December29.7°F (-1.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
